Or take a day and explore Nemours Mansion - the 300-acre country estate of the late industrialist and philanthropist Alfred I. duPont. Located on the grounds of the renowned Alfred I. duPont Hospital for Children in Wilmington, Delaware, it derives its name from the town in France represented by Mr. duPont's great-great-grandfather, Pierre Samuel duPont de Nemours, as a member of the French Estates General in 1789. The mansion was built from 1909 to 1910 and is a fine example of a French chateau in the style of Louis XVIth. The 47,000 sq. ft. mansion looms over the surrounding formal gardens and is furnished with fine antiques,Edgar Allen Poe - The Raven famous works of art, beautiful tapestries, and other treasures. The grounds surrounding the mansion extend for one third of a mile along the main vista from the house, and are among the finest examples of French-style gardens in the United States.

Or in the mood for something a little bit eerie?  The Deer Park Tavern is a favorite of University of Delaware students, faculty and townsfolk. It was built in 1851 at the western end of the Main Street commercial district, to replace an earlier inn which had been built in 1747. Mason and Dixon stayed at that earlier inn while carrying out the survey work on the Mason Dixon boundary line, which forms most of the western border of Delaware, running due south from the Newark area to Delaware's southern border.
